Appendix B: Newborn Eligibility Process

The [Newborn Eligibility Form (MA 112)] must be filled out when a current MA recipient gives birth. The form includes instructions for filling it out.

 

NOTE: MA providers who are registered COMPASS Community Partners can use COMPASS Newborn Add to report a newborn’s birth through COMPASS. Newborn Add can be used by the provider in place of submitting a paper MA112.

Reminder: A child born to an MA or CHIP recipient is automatically eligible for MA effective the date of birth. A separate application on eligibility determination is not needed for the child.
